94v Nylon Cable Tie Sourcing Guide
The 94v nylon cable tie is a critical component for securing and organizing electrical wiring in environments where fire safety is paramount. These fasteners are engineered to self-extinguish upon exposure to an open flame, a property defined by the UL 94 V-0 rating, which prevents the spread of fire along cable bundles. In industrial and commercial settings, the material choice of nylon ensures durability against environmental stressors while maintaining the structural integrity required for heavy-duty binding applications. Buyers must recognize that while the core function remains consistent, the specific formulation of the nylon and the manufacturing process can significantly influence the tie's performance under extreme thermal or mechanical loads.
Procuring these items requires a disciplined approach to distinguishing between standard and high-performance variants, as not all nylon ties meet the stringent 94V flame retardant criteria. The market offers a spectrum of options ranging from general-purpose ties to those specifically rated for high flame resistance, often indicated by specific material additives or processing techniques. Sourcing decisions should be driven by the specific safety requirements of the end application, ensuring that the selected product aligns with the necessary fire safety standards for the intended installation environment.

Technical Specifications to Verify
Dimensional accuracy is the primary technical specification to verify, as the width and length of the cable tie directly impact its holding capacity and fit. Listings frequently cite specific models such as 2.5-12mm or 7.2x200mm, but buyers must confirm that the actual product dimensions match the project requirements to avoid installation failures. The material composition is equally critical, with nylon being the standard base material, often reinforced to achieve the 94V flame rating. Verification should include checking the specific grade of nylon and the presence of flame-retardant additives, as these factors determine the tie's ability to withstand high temperatures and resist combustion.
The mechanical properties, including tensile strength and UV resistance, are essential for long-term reliability, particularly in outdoor or industrial applications. While some listings mention high flame retardancy, others specify normal ratings, indicating a need to distinguish between general-purpose and safety-critical applications. Buyers should also verify the locking mechanism type, such as self-locking features, to ensure the tie remains secure under vibration or thermal expansion. Additionally, the color and finish of the tie can serve as indicators of material quality, with black being a common standard that often implies the inclusion of carbon black for UV protection.
Compliance and Safety Documentation
Certification is a non-negotiable aspect of sourcing 94v nylon cable ties, as these products must adhere to rigorous safety standards to be legally and safely deployed in many industries. The observed market data highlights a prevalence of certifications including CE, ISO, RoHS, SGS, and CCC, which collectively validate the product's compliance with international safety and environmental regulations. Buyers must request and verify these certificates to ensure that the supplier has undergone independent testing and that the product meets the specific regulatory requirements of the target market. The presence of multiple certifications often indicates a higher level of quality control and adherence to global standards.
Fire safety documentation is particularly critical, as the 94V rating is a specific classification under the UL 94 standard for flammability of plastic materials. Buyers should demand test reports that explicitly confirm the 94V-0 rating, ensuring the material self-extinguishes within a specified time frame when exposed to a flame. While some listings mention a "94V" rating, the absence of detailed test data or specific standard references should trigger a request for further documentation. Relying solely on marketing claims without verified test results can lead to compliance failures and safety hazards in the final application.
